  10 powerful natural ingredients for glowing skin  

1. Aloe Vera

Aloevera

Aloe vera is one of the most popular natural skincare ingredients and for good reason. Rich in vitamins, enzymes, and anti-inflammatory properties, it helps soothe irritation, reduce acne, and deeply hydrate the skin.

How to use:
Apply fresh aloe vera gel directly to your face, leave on for 10–15 minutes, then rinse with cool water. Use 3–4 times a week.


2. Honey

honey

Raw honey is a natural humectant, which means it pulls moisture into your skin. It also contains antibacterial properties, making it ideal for treating acne and dull skin.

How to use:
Spread a thin layer of raw honey over clean skin, let it sit for 15 minutes, and rinse off. For exfoliation, mix it with sugar or coffee grounds.


 

3. Turmeric

turmeric

Known for its bright yellow hue, turmeric is a powerful antioxidant and anti-inflammatory ingredient. It reduces dark spots, acne scars, and improves skin tone.

How to use:
Mix 1 tsp turmeric powder with yogurt or honey and apply as a mask. Use once or twice a week for visible results.

Note: Do a patch test—turmeric may temporarily stain skin.


 

4. Cucumber

cucumber

Cucumber is packed with water and antioxidants that soothe irritated or sunburned skin. It’s also known to reduce puffiness and refresh tired skin.

How to use:
Apply thin cucumber slices directly to the skin or blend it into a mask with aloe vera or yogurt.


5. Rose Water

rose water

Rose water is a natural toner that balances pH, controls excess oil, and tightens pores. Its floral aroma is an added bonus!

How to use:
Spray rose water on your face after cleansing or use it to dilute masks. You can also store it in a mini mist bottle for all-day hydration.


6. Papaya

papaya

Papaya contains papain, an enzyme that helps gently exfoliate dead skin cells. It brightens your complexion and smooths out rough patches.

How to use:
Mash ripe papaya and apply to your face. Leave on for 10–15 minutes before rinsing. Great for a weekly glow-boosting mask.


 

7. Green Tea

green tea

Green tea is full of antioxidants like EGCG, which help protect the skin from sun damage, reduce redness, and fight premature aging.

How to use:
Steep green tea, let it cool, and use it as a toner. You can also add cooled green tea to DIY face masks.


8. Coconut Oil

coconut oil

Coconut oil is a deep moisturizer perfect for dry or flaky skin. It also has antimicrobial properties that help prevent breakouts.

How to use:
Massage a small amount onto clean, damp skin at night. Best for dry or normal skin types. Avoid if you’re prone to acne.


9. Lemon

lemon

Lemon juice contains vitamin C, which helps lighten dark spots and even out skin tone. It’s especially useful for oily and acne-prone skin.

How to use:
Mix a few drops of lemon juice with honey or rose water. Apply only at night and always rinse thoroughly. Use 1–2 times per week.

Do not apply directly or go into sunlight after applying—can cause photosensitivity.


 

10. Yogurt

yogurt

Yogurt is full of lactic acid, which gently exfoliates and brightens dull skin. It also calms inflammation and hydrates dry areas.

How to use:
Use plain, unsweetened yogurt as a face mask for 10–15 minutes. You can mix it with turmeric, honey, or oats for added benefits.
